About By Association Only (BAO) BAO is a globally award-winning Shopify Plus eCommerce agency based in the UK. We’re a senior team of designers, developers and marketers that are committed to exceptional standards in eCommerce. We work explicitly with Shopify Plus merchants - generally in the fashion, cosmetics and luxury goods sectors for brands all over the world in competitive global markets. We work in a studio where independence, autonomy and doing the right thing is at the centre of everything we do. As an agency we’re on a mission to work with the world's most ambitious eCommerce brands and we do this in an environment that is smart, open, fast-paced, fun and rewarding. Although we're headquartered in Cambridge, we are staffed by around 70% permanently remote employees that are located all over the UK. All of our team members are full time employees.
Job Summary We’re looking for talented, conscientious, and ambitious developers who want to work on exciting e-Commerce projects for global brands. We’re drawn to people who are naturally curious, enjoy problem solving, and share our ambition to build a global agency with a reputation for excellence in both product and service.
Skills / Experience We feel passionately that the role will excite the right individual due to the opportunity to work with some fantastic brands, from ambitious funded startups through to large enterprise merchants across a wide variety of market sectors.
- Hands-on experience working with an e-Commerce platform such as Shopify, Magento, or BigCommerce
- At least 2 years experience contributing to active projects/websites
- Ability to write well-structured, semantic, and accessible HTML and CSS
- An excellent understanding of JavaScript, with strong knowledge of Web Components
- Solid understanding of core web development principles and front-end performance best practices
- Building complex interactions in a performant way, with a high degree of polish
- Strong awareness of WCAG 2.1 AA accessibility requirements
- Experience working with modern web stacks including build tools, transpilers, linters, build and CI tools
- Solid understanding of Git and version control and working within a team of multiple developers
Bonus Points for:
- Working in an agency or creative studio environment delivering websites for a variety of clients
- Hands-on technical experience with an e-Commerce platform
- A deep understanding of one or more specific client-side areas like animation, performance, or accessibility for example
- Experience with a common back-end language or framework, preferably Ruby or Node

Become part of our Carbon Positive workforce Every one of our staff members are climate positive. BAO contributes a monthly payment per employee, planting trees around the world on behalf of its team. This means as an employee of BAO you’ll be offsetting your entire carbon footprint, including emissions from your home, personal travel, holidays, food, hobbies and more.
